- npm ci: 按package.lock.json安装包
- npm version: 升级包,更新版本号
- npm view packageName version: 查看包当前版本
- npm view packageName versions: 查看包所有版本
- npm info packageName: 查看当前包信息
- npm ls packageName: 查看包信息
- npm ou: 查看已更新的包
npm i
npm install packageName //本地安装,安装到项目目录下,不在package.json中写入依赖
npm install packageName -g //全局安装,安装在Node安装目录下的node_modules下
npm install packageName --save //安装到项目目录下,并在package.json文件的dependencies中写入依赖,简写为-S
npm install packageName --save-dev //安装到项目目录下,并在package.json文件的devDependencies中写入依赖,简写为-D
npm 源
npm config get registry // 查看npm当前镜像源
npm config set registry https://registry.npm.taobao.org/ // 设置npm镜像源为淘宝镜像
npm config set @mi:registry xxx // 设置”@mi“开头的包的源为:xxx
vim ~/.npmrc // 编辑user config file
yarn config get registry // 查看yarn当前镜像源
yarn config set registry https://registry.npm.taobao.org/ // 设置yarn镜像源为淘宝镜像